NOVELTY - Paint comprises 40-60 pts. wt. emulsion matrix, 10-20 pts. wt. water, 5-10 pts. wt. pigment, 1-5 pts. wt. mineral fiber, 6-10 pts. wt. antibacterial filler, 0.2-2 pts. wt. silane coupling agent, 3-4 pts. wt. dispersant, 1-2 pts. wt. defoamer, 2-3 pts. wt. wetting agent and 2-3 pts. wt. film-forming auxiliary agent. USE - The paint is useful as art paint (claimed), interior wall of building, door vestibule, vestibules, television background wall, toilet and kitchen. ADVANTAGE - The paint: is aqueous; and has excellent film-forming properties, environmental stability and antibacterial function.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An INDEPENDENT CLAIM is included for preparing paint, comprising (i) mixing graphene solution and silver nitrate with ultrasonic-assisted stirring for 5-9 hours to obtain graphene-supported silver ion mixture, where the concentration of graphene is 1.4-7.5 g/l, and the concentration of silver ions in silver ion solution is 500-3000 ppm, (ii) stirring and mixing graphene-loaded silver ion mixture, four-needle zinc oxide, and vinyl triethoxysilane, sieving and drying to obtain modified antibacterial filler, where the mass fraction of graphene is 4-7%, the mass fraction of silver ions is 0.5-0.7%, and the mass fraction of four-needle zinc oxide is 3-8.5%, the mass fraction of vinyltriethoxysilane is 0.2-0.65%, the stirring temperature is 25-40℃, the stirring speed is 180-550 revolutions/minutes, and the stirring time is 8-15 minutes, (iii) measuring 3-5 pts. wt. titanium dioxide, 2-7 pts. wt. talc, 1-3 pts. wt. superfine calcium stearate, 0.5-2 pts. wt. colored sand, 0.3-0.7 pts. wt. quartz sand, 0.5-2 pts. wt. nano calcium carbonate, 1-5 pts. wt. mineral fiber and water with mixer, stirring at 25-40℃, stirring at speed of 180-550 revolutions/minutes for 8-15 minutes, (iv) mixing mixture with specific amount of emulsion base, water, dispersant, defoamer, wetting agent, and film-forming aid, and uniformly stirring, to obtain final product, where the stirring temperature is 30-50℃, the stirring speed is 900-1500 revolutions/minutes, and the stirring time is 10-18 minutes.
